What is a Dental Bridge?
A dental bridge is a fixed replacement for one or more missing teeth. It is held in place by nearby teeth or dental implants and helps restore your smile and the way your mouth works.
Dental bridges can help:
- Replace one or more missing teeth.
- Make chewing easier
- Improve the appearance of your smile.
- Keep nearby teeth from shifting.
- Support a healthy bite.
The goal is to give you a smile that looks natural and works comfortably.
How Does a Smile Look Before a Dental Bridge?
Before treatment, missing teeth can affect both your smile and the way your mouth works. Even one missing tooth can cause problems over time.
Common problems include:
- Gaps in your smile
- Trouble chewing some foods
- Nearby teeth are moving into the space.
- An uneven bite
- Feeling less confident when smiling
These problems can become worse if they are not treated.
What Changes Happen After a Dental Bridge?
After treatment, patients usually notice a clear improvement in both function and appearance. The gap is filled with a natural-looking replacement tooth.
Typical missing tooth replacement results include:
- A complete and balanced smile
- Improved chewing ability
- Better bite alignment
- Reduced movement of nearby teeth
- More natural facial appearance
The restored tooth blends with the surrounding teeth for a more uniform look.
How Does the Treatment Process Work?
A few visits are typically required to create the artificial tooth and fit the dental bridge. Each step is purposefully designed to guarantee a proper fit.
Usually includes steps
- Testing and Imaging.
- Getting ready for adjacent teeth.
- Making impressions
- Making the tailor-made bridge.
- Final positioning and changes.
Every step guarantees a safe and natural outcome.

How to Care for a Dental Bridge?
Taking good care of a dental bridge can lengthen the life of the bridge.
Tips for nurturing care.
- Two times daily brushing.
- Cleaning under the bridge using floss or special tools.
- Stay away from hard food
- Going for dental checkups
- Brushing and flossing daily
